browsing the code, i see:
;; XXX: These are all too similar -- need to do some refactoring.
;; XXX: also, those list-ref calls are gross.
;;; Return an <http-response> with the headers for the given URI.
(define (http-head uri)
(let* ((parts (parse-uri uri))
(request (make <http-request>
#:method "HEAD"
#:server (list-ref parts 1)
#:port (list-ref parts 2) #:uri (list-ref parts 3)
#:headers (list (cons "User-Agent" "(net http)/0.1")
(cons "Host" (list-ref parts 1)))))
(response (send-request request)))
(close (get-content response))
response))
you might investigate writing / finding a `destructuring-bind' macro.
let me know if you do, because i'd like to use it, too.
